What Affects the Cost
Walkway demolition projects in Spartanburg, SC, can vary widely depending on the scope and materials involved.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and budgeting for removal of old or damaged walkways. This overview provides general information about common factors influencing walkway demolition costs and options.
- Materials: Common materials include concrete, brick, stone, or asphalt, each requiring different removal methods and tools.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ential paths to larger commercial walkways, affecting labor and equipment needs.
- Labor Complexity: Demolition complexity depends on the walkway’s design, embedded reinforcements, and accessibility.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Spartanburg may require permits for certain demolition projects, especially larger or structural removals.
- Additional Services: Disposal, site cleanup, and potential foundation removal are often part of walkway demolition considerations.
Cost by Size or Scope
Walkway Demolition
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small residential walkways (up to 50 sq ft) | $500 - $1,500 |
| Medium concrete walkways (50-150 sq ft) | $1,500 - $4,000 |
| Large walkways or multiple sections | $4,000 - $10,000 |
| Asphalt walkways | $1,200 - $3,500 |
